Creamy and Popular Bechamel sauce

Creamy and popular bechamel sauce (molho de béchamel), is often used in Portuguese dishes, and it is a good base for sauces.

Ingredients

2 cups of milk1/4 cup of butter1/3 cup of flourNutmeg (to taste)Salt (to taste)Pepper (to taste)

Preparation

  1. In a small pan, heat the butter and stir until frothy, then add the flour and stir well.
  2. Add the milk gradually, always beating with a wire rod until the sauce begins to boil.
  3. Let it simmer for another 2 minutes, stirring constantly until it thickens.
  4. Season with salt, pepper and nutmeg, stir well and use.
